A well-designed bath bomb box packaging will make your product look good and also encourage consumers to buy more of it. Here are five tips for designing the perfect printed box:
- Make sure your design is eye-catching and memorable;
- Include a strong call to actions
- Use color strategically by using vibrant colors like red and blue for high impact, and pale pastels for a soothing effect;
- Create contrast with white space, which helps draw attention to your message;
- Keep it simple – too many words on the packaging can confuse potential customers
